The Police are among 15 nominees for this coming year's 2003 Rock Hall Of Fame. About 7 of the nominees will be inducted in December. The official celebration with performances will be in the Spring. This is the first time the Police have been nominated and the first year they were eligible. Other nominees this year include The Clash, Elvis Costello and the Attractions, ABBA, Chic, Kraftwerk, Black Sabbath, AC/DC, The Dells, MC5, The Righteous Brothers, The Patti Smith Group, Lynyrd Skynyrd, and Steve Winwood.

The Police and the Clash are the only artist that are considered to be a lock for this year's inductees. Perhaps we will see the first Police performance in public since June 15, 1986 at GIANTS STADIUM, sometime in the spring of 2003 at the awards.
